Steward's Report
Trainer, J. Rinaldi was fined the sum of $50 for her failure to produce the registration card for the greyhound Ice Cold Bundy pursuant to GAR 33.
Pure Onyx, Advice Aplenty and Another Halo were quick to begin. Tear Away Kuda and Ice Cold Bundy collided soon after the start. Blurton and Mag Spring collided approaching the first turn. Advice Aplenty, Pure Onyx and Another Halo collided on the first turn. Blurton and Mag Spring collided on the first turn, checking Blurton.
Blurton was vetted following the event. It was reported that there was no apparent injury found.
A sample was taken from Advice Aplenty - the winner of the event.
